Rothschild Bordeaux Rouge
A classic Bordeaux style from the Rothschild house — approachable, structured and with the typical character of the Gironde in the glass.
Baron Philippe de Rothschild is one of the most renowned wineries in the Médoc and has been responsible for both the iconic Pauillac wines and more approachable everyday cuvées for decades. This Bordeaux Rouge represents the estate's classic craftsmanship: Cabernet Sauvignon and Merlot from the Bordeaux appellation, vinified according to the time-honored Méthode Bordelaise.
The nose offers dark berry fruits—plum and blackberry—underpinned by forest floor and a subtle spiciness. On the palate, it is round and completely dry, with firm tannins that are well integrated and leave no harsh finish. A discreet minerality adds freshness.
- Food: Entrecôte, lamb loin with herb crust, mature cheddar or a braised dish on cool evenings
- Temperature: 16–18 °C, preferably open 30 minutes before pouring.
- Occasion: An uncomplicated companion to dinner — or enjoyed solo in front of the fireplace
